ในโลกที่เต็มไปด้วยข้อมูล ทุกวันเราทำงานกับข้อมูลต่าง ๆ ไม่ว่าจะเป็นข้อมูลลูกค้า สินค้า หรือแม้กระทั่งข้อมูลการบัญชี สิ่งสำคัญคือการจัดเก็บข้อมูลเหล่านี้อย่างมีประสิทธิภาพและสามารถเข้าถึงได้ง่าย นี่คือที่มาของฐานข้อมูล และสำหรับบทความนี้เราจะพูดถึง MySQL ซึ่งเป็นหนึ่งในระบบจัดการฐานข้อมูลที่ใช้งานได้ง่าย และ Groovy เป็นภาษาโปรแกรมที่ช่วยให้การทำงานกับ MySQL เป็นเรื่องที่สนุกและง่ายดายยิ่งขึ้น
MySQL เป็นระบบจัดการฐานข้อมูลเชิงสัมพันธ์ (RDBMS) ที่เป็นที่นิยมอย่างแพร่หลาย โดยเฉพาะในแอปพลิเคชันเว็บเพื่อรองรับการจัดเก็บและเข้าถึงข้อมูล โครงสร้างของ MySQL ทำให้ผู้ใช้สามารถสร้าง ตาราง ฟิลด์ และกำหนดความสัมพันธ์ระหว่างข้อมูลได้อย่างง่ายดาย
Groovy เป็นภาษาการเขียนโปรแกรมที่ถูกออกแบบมาให้เข้ากันได้กับ Java โดยให้โครงสร้างที่ง่ายและกระชับมากยิ่งขึ้น ซึ่งทำให้มันกลายเป็นทางเลือกที่ดีในการพัฒนาแอปพลิเคชันที่ต้องทำงานร่วมกับฐานข้อมูล
การสร้างตารางใน MySQL ด้วย Groovy นั้นสามารถทำได้อย่างง่ายดายด้วยการใช้ JDBC (Java Database Connectivity) ซึ่งช่วยให้สามารถเชื่อมต่อกับฐานข้อมูลได้
ขั้นตอนการสร้างตาราง
1. ลงทะเบียนฐานข้อมูล: การลงทะเบียนฐานข้อมูลใน MySQL จะต้องทำการเชื่อมต่อกับข้อมูลที่เราจะใช้ 2. สร้างคำสั่ง SQL: สร้างคำสั่ง SQL สำหรับการสร้างตาราง 3. ดำเนินการคำสั่ง: ใช้ Groovy เพื่อดำเนินการคำสั่ง SQLตัวอย่าง CODE
อธิบายการทำงานของ CODE
1. Import Library: เราต้องการใช้งาน Groovy SQL ดังนั้นจึงต้อง import `groovy.sql.Sql` 2. เชื่อมต่อฐานข้อมูล: โดยระบุ URL ของฐานข้อมูล ชื่อผู้ใช้ และรหัสผ่าน จากนั้นเราจะสร้างอินสแตนซ์ของ `Sql` ที่ใช้ในการทำงานกับฐานข้อมูล 3. สร้างคำสั่ง SQL: เราสร้างคำสั่ง SQL ที่ใช้ในการสร้างตาราง `Users` โดยมีฟิลด์ที่เราต้องการ เช่น `id`, `username`, `password`, `email`, และ `created_at` 4. ดำเนินการคำสั่ง SQL: เมื่อคำสั่ง SQL ถูกสร้างขึ้นแล้ว เราก็ใช้ `sql.execute(createTableQuery)` เพื่อสร้างตารางตามคำสั่งที่เรากำหนด 5. ปิดการเชื่อมต่อ: เมื่อการทำงานเสร็จสิ้น เราควรปิดการเชื่อมต่อฐานข้อมูลเพื่อทำให้ทรัพยากรถูกใช้ถนอม 6. พิมพ์ข้อความ: สุดท้ายเราก็พิมพ์ข้อความว่าการสร้างตารางประสบความสำเร็จ
เรามีการใช้งานตาราง `Users` นี้อยู่ในเว็บแอปพลิเคชันที่ช่วยให้ผู้ใช้สามารถลงทะเบียนและจัดการบัญชีส่วนตัวของพวกเขา เช่น การเปลี่ยนแปลงรหัสผ่าน การอัปเดตข้อมูลส่วนตัว หรือแม้กระทั่งการตั้งค่าการรักษาความปลอดภัย การสร้างตารางที่มีความปลอดภัยและจัดระเบียบจะช่วยเราจัดการกับข้อมูลเหล่านี้ได้อย่างมีประสิทธิภาพ
สรุป
การทำงานกับฐานข้อมูล MySQL ใน Groovy นั้นทำได้อย่างเรียบง่าย หากคุณยังไม่เคยลองใช้ Groovy ในการสร้างแอปพลิเคชันที่เชื่อมต่อกับฐานข้อมูล ลองเริ่มกันเลย!
และหากคุณต้องการเรียนรู้เพิ่มเติมเกี่ยวกับการเขียนโปรแกรมและพัฒนาทักษะการเขียนโปรแกรมที่คุณต้องการแล้ว EPT (Expert-Programming-Tutor) เป็นสถานที่ที่เหมาะสมสำหรับคุณ ด้วยหลักสูตรที่สอนโดยผู้มีประสบการณ์ คุณจะได้รับความรู้และทักษะที่จำเป็นในการพัฒนาโปรแกรมที่คุณต้องการมากยิ่งขึ้น!
ชวนทุกคนมาเริ่มเรียนรู้การเขียนโปรแกรมกับ EPT
ไม่ว่าคุณจะเป็นมือใหม่หรือมีประสบการณ์ในการเขียนโปรแกรมแล้ว การเรียนรู้กับ EPT จะทำให้คุณมีความเชี่ยวชาญในการเขียนโค้ดและใช้งานกับฐานข้อมูลในปัจจุบัน การลงทะเบียนเรียนในหลักสูตรที่เหมาะสมจะจะทำให้คุณได้เข้าถึงความรู้ที่มีคุณค่า มาร่วมเป็นส่วนหนึ่งกับเราใน EPT และเริ่มเปลี่ยนความฝันของคุณให้เป็นจริงกันเถอะ!
หมายเหตุ: ข้อมูลในบทความนี้อาจจะผิด โปรดตรวจสอบความถูกต้องของบทความอีกครั้งหนึ่ง บทความนี้ไม่สามารถนำไปใช้อ้างอิงใด ๆ ได้ ทาง EPT ไม่ขอยืนยันความถูกต้อง และไม่ขอรับผิดชอบต่อความเสียหายใดที่เกิดจากบทความชุดนี้ทั้งทางทรัพย์สิน ร่างกาย หรือจิตใจของผู้อ่านและผู้เกี่ยวข้อง
Tag ที่น่าสนใจ: java c# vb.net python c c++ machine_learning web database oop cloud aws ios android
หากมีข้อผิดพลาด/ต้องการพูดคุยเพิ่มเติมเกี่ยวกับบทความนี้ กรุณาแจ้งที่ http://m.me/Expert.Programming.Tutor
085-350-7540 (DTAC)
084-88-00-255 (AIS)
026-111-618
หรือทาง EMAIL: NTPRINTF@GMAIL.COM